"Autobiography of Goethe Volume 2" delves into the life and thoughts of Johann Wolfgang von Goethe, one of the most influential figures in German literature. This volume continues to explore his personal journey, reflecting on his experiences, philosophies, and the artistic movements of his time. Goethe's insights into human nature, creativity, and the quest for knowledge remain profoundly relevant today, as they resonate with contemporary discussions about self-discovery and the role of art in society.
